@Lauren_BWIS@OpenSciEd@modernclassproj Yep, a Google Sheet with Lesson numbers on the top. I break OSE lessons up into multiple MCP lessons, each with their own Lesson Question… which serves as the mastery check.

We HAVE Google Classroom, but I find myself getting lost in it, and I don't want my students to also get lost. I make a website for each of my units, and link it (and our Daily Check-in) at the top of the Google Classroom stream!
